Importance Of Electrical Panel Safety
Electrical panels control the flow of electricity in a building. They keep the power safe and organized. Proper safety with electrical panels helps stop accidents and fires.
Knowing how to handle electrical panels is important for every home and workplace. It protects people and electrical equipment from damage.
Keep Electrical Panels Dry And Clean
Water and dust can cause short circuits and fires in electrical panels. Always keep the panel area dry and free of dirt. Avoid placing liquids near the panel.
Avoid Overloading Circuits
Overloading circuits can cause overheating and damage. Check the panel’s capacity and do not connect too many devices to one circuit. Use professional help for panel upgrades.
Regular Inspection And Maintenance
Inspect electrical panels regularly to find problems early. Look for signs like rust, loose wires, or burning smells. Maintenance keeps the panel safe and working well.
- Check for corrosion and rust on panel parts
- Tighten any loose screws or wires
- Replace damaged or worn-out components
- Test circuit breakers for proper function
Know Emergency Procedures
In case of an electrical emergency, quick action can save lives. Know how to shut off the main power switch safely. Call a licensed electrician if there is any problem.
| Emergency Action | Why It Is Important |
| Turn off main power | Stops electricity flow to prevent shock or fire |
| Use a fire extinguisher | Put out electrical fires safely |
| Call a professional | Ensures expert help to fix problems |

Signs Of Electrical Panel Issues
Electrical panels control the power in your home. Problems in the panel can cause serious safety risks. Recognizing signs of trouble early can prevent damage.
Check your electrical panel often for warning signs. These signs tell you when to call a professional electrician.
Frequent Circuit Breaker Trips
Circuit breakers stop the flow of electricity to protect your home. If they trip often, it shows a problem. This can mean overloaded circuits or faulty wiring.
- Too many devices on one circuit
- Short circuits in wiring
- Old or damaged breakers
Burning Smell Or Sparks
A burning smell near the panel is a serious warning. Sparks or smoke are signs of overheating or electrical shorts. Turn off power and call an expert immediately.
Discolored Or Warm Panel
Look for dark stains or melted areas on the panel cover. The panel should not feel warm to the touch. Heat shows loose connections or overloaded circuits.
| Warning Sign | Possible Cause |
| Discoloration | Overheating or burnt wires |
| Warm Panel | Loose connections or overload |
| Melted Plastic | Electrical fire risk |
Flickering Lights
Lights that flicker or dim often point to electrical panel issues. This can be caused by loose wiring or circuit problems. It may also mean your panel is too small for your home’s needs.
Check these causes of flickering lights:
- Loose wire connections
- Faulty breakers
- Old electrical panels
- High power demand

Emergency Response Tips
Electrical panels can be dangerous if not handled correctly. Knowing how to react during an emergency can save lives and property.
Follow safety steps carefully to reduce risks during electrical problems.
Handling Electrical Fires
Do not use water to put out an electrical fire. Water conducts electricity and can cause shocks.
Use a Class C fire extinguisher made for electrical fires. If you do not have one, turn off power first.
- Stay calm and alert others nearby
- Switch off the power at the main panel if safe
- Use a fire extinguisher rated for electrical fires
- Call emergency services if fire grows
- Do not try to fight large fires yourself
First Aid For Electric Shock
Do not touch a person still in contact with electricity. You can get shocked too.
Turn off the power source or use a non-conductive object to move the person away safely.
- Call emergency services immediately
- Check if the person is breathing and has a pulse
- If not breathing, start CPR if trained
- Keep the person lying down and warm
- Do not give food or drink until fully conscious
When To Evacuate
Leave the area if you see smoke, fire, or smell burning. Electrical fires spread fast.
Evacuate if the electrical panel is damaged or sparking. Stay away from water near the panel.
- Alert others and guide them to safety
- Use the nearest safe exit
- Do not use elevators
- Call emergency services from a safe place
- Wait for firefighters before returning inside
